I hqve not been able to create new classes when using texniccenter,
such as those for specific journal submissions. The journal provides a
.cls file and .clo files for download, but I cannot seem to put them
anywhere that Latex can find them. Is there omething that I can do?

You could read what your TeX distribution describes as the proper
places (paths) to install these files in and whether and how they
have to be put into hash files (via maketexlsr, texhash).
A second means could be to describe precisely what actually fails at
which step ...
